Deconstructor



Destructors are called when an object gets destroyed. It’s the polar opposite of the constructor, which gets called on creation.

These methods are only called on creation and destruction of the object. They are not called manually but completely automatic.

Deconstructor

Related course:Python Programming Courses & Exercises

python destructor

Atomic Deconstructor: Each of your attack has a very low percent to instant kill mobs and player. Bane of Arthropods: Increases damage to arthropods. Mutually exclusive with Smite and Sharpness. Has lesser, advanced and supreme variants. V Blast Protection: Reduces explosion damage and knockback. Mutually exclusive with other protections. Deconstructing the economic theories of John Maynard Keynes Recent Examples on the Web The nonprofit is also keen on making its work inclusive with sessions on LGBTQ relationships, abuse in relationships with disabled partners, and using the signs of relationship violence to deconstruct. Mens Deconstructor (Lasting Thickness and Root Lift Firm Hold Dry Matt Finish) - 50ml/1.7oz New (5) from $12.66 & FREE Shipping on orders over $25.00 Frequently bought together.

A destructor can do the opposite of a constructor, but that isn’t necessarily true. It can do something different. A destructor is a function called when an object is deleted or destroyed.

An object is destroyed by calling:

Deconstructor

Before the object is destroyed, you can do some final tasks. Imagine driving a Tesla and in the code the engine object gets destroyed. No, first you’d want to shutdown the engine, make sure the wheels are not spinning etc.

Take into mind that destroying an object with del is optional, you can create objects and never delete them. They are then only deleted when the program closes. However, this can eat up a lot of memory in large programs.

A destructor has this format:

It is always part of a class, even if not defined. (If not defined, Python assumes an empty destructor).

Example

The class below has a constructor (init) and destructor (del). We create an instance from the class and delete it right after.

An example of using destructor is shown in the code below:

If you run the above program, you can see this output in the terminal:

Deconstructor

Deconstructor C#

The output is displayed, even though we didn’t call any methods. That’s because a constructor and destructor are called automatically.

Deconstructor Warframe

If you are a Python beginner, then I highly recommend this book. Car mechanic simulator 2018 free.